Can You Really Save Money by Moving Without Movers?

Many individuals question whether relocating without professional movers truly saves money. While it's tempting to believe that DIY moving signals significant cost savings, the truth can be more nuanced. Factors such as distance, amount of belongings, and convenience of your current and new dwellings all play a role in determining if a DIY move is truly affordable.

  • Distance: If you're moving long distances, the costs of renting a truck, gasoline, and potential lodging can quickly accumulate, possibly exceeding the savings of hiring movers.
  • Belongings: A large quantity of belongings often demands professional packing and loading services. Attempting to manage this yourself can be time-consuming and possibly result in damage.
  • Access/Obstacles: Difficult access to your current or new home, such as narrow streets or stairs, can hamper a DIY move and potentially increase the risk of accident.

Ultimately, carefully considering your specific circumstances is essential to decide if a DIY move truly offers cost savings.
